## Deploying the Gatewick Proctor Queue

Deploys are pretty painless: push to main, wait for the pipeline, then watch the queue drain dashboard for five minutes. If candidates pile up mid-exam, roll back first and ask questions later — the queue replays safely. Everything the workers care about lives in one config block, shown here for reference.

settings of bafof-yagef:
JOROX_PIN=8740
JOROX_TENANT=pelox
JOROX_METRICS_HOST=metrics.jorox.qorvelworks.internal
JOROX_SEAL=seal_c78f63c1
JOROX_STANDBY_TEAM=norax

## Runbook: Driftline websocket reconnect bug

Symptom: clients on the Driftline gateway reconnect in tight loops after a deploy, hammering the handshake endpoint. Root cause was the server dropping sessions before the client backoff kicked in. Mitigation: stagger gateway restarts and confirm the backoff jitter is enabled. Do not raise the max connection cap as a workaround; it masks the loop. If the loop persists past ten minutes, roll back the gateway. Verify the live settings match the intended values listed here.

deployment values, fahap-hahaf:
[casdor]
port = 9200
region = south-2
host = casdor.qirvanworks.corp
timeout_ms = 3000
retries = 4

### Checklist: Markdown rendering pipeline

Confirm the Inkfold renderer passes the full fixture suite: tables, nested lists, and fenced blocks must match golden output exactly. Sanitizer rules for embedded HTML are unchanged this cycle; verify anyway. Preview and export paths must use the same renderer version. The verified build token is recorded below.

pipeline stamp: htk3_cc5